Hi, I'm kaisa, the main face behind the clay collective! 

​

An ever-evolving space, our beloved ceramic studio started out as a shared studio space between 3 artists and over the years has transformed mainly into a teaching space where I have the great pleasure of sharing my craft with the community of Revelstoke. â€‹

​

I still share the space with my studio mate, Gabrielle who you may also know through the name Monashee Pottery and during the day you can often find us working on our own pieces.
